From patchwork Mon Sep 8 15:46:55 2014 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: ANDY KENNEDY X-Patchwork-Id: 386977 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Received: from fraxinus.osuosl.org (fraxinus.osuosl.org [140.211.166.137]) by ozlabs.org (Postfix) with ESMTP id 0D2FE140142 for ; Tue, 9 Sep 2014 01:56:00 +1000 (EST) Received: from localhost (localhost [127.0.0.1]) by fraxinus.osuosl.org (Postfix) with ESMTP id 7A263A0E8C; Mon, 8 Sep 2014 15:55:58 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from fraxinus.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id Wd5AYrRf9G33; Mon, 8 Sep 2014 15:55:58 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by fraxinus.osuosl.org (Postfix) with ESMTP id E0C1AA0E86; Mon, 8 Sep 2014 15:55:57 +0000 (UTC) X-Original-To: buildroot@lists.busybox.net Delivered-To: buildroot@osuosl.org Received: from silver.osuosl.org (silver.osuosl.org [140.211.166.136]) by ash.osuosl.org (Postfix) with ESMTP id 56BAB1BF863 for ; Mon, 8 Sep 2014 15:55:56 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by silver.osuosl.org (Postfix) with ESMTP id 538032640F for ; Mon, 8 Sep 2014 15:55:56 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from silver.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 6ef+1pmzd6Bm for ; Mon, 8 Sep 2014 15:55:55 +0000 (UTC) X-Greylist: from auto-whitelisted by SQLgrey-1.7.6 Received: from p02c12o147.mxlogic.net (p02c12o147.mxlogic.net [208.65.145.80]) by silver.osuosl.org (Postfix) with ESMTPS id 70669329CB for ; Mon, 8 Sep 2014 15:55:55 +0000 (UTC) Received: from unknown [76.164.174.82] (EHLO ex-hc3.corp.adtran.com) by p02c12o147.mxlogic.net(mxl_mta-8.1.0-0) with ESMTP id b81dd045.2ae78ba38940.44058.00-514.124361.p02c12o147.mxlogic.net (envelope-from ); Mon, 08 Sep 2014 09:55:55 -0600 (MDT) X-MXL-Hash: 540dd18b05488eb9-7d3bc4d117592909514cf827b4a7172a0215b17c Received: from unknown [76.164.174.82] (EHLO ex-hc3.corp.adtran.com) by p02c12o147.mxlogic.net(mxl_mta-8.1.0-0) over TLS secured channel with ESMTP id 27fcd045.0.37215.00-224.104928.p02c12o147.mxlogic.net (envelope-from ); Mon, 08 Sep 2014 09:47:01 -0600 (MDT) X-MXL-Hash: 540dcf757c4d46ca-82e80f8ede66d0cf4645b100b7afadeb74902e88 Received: from ex-mb3.corp.adtran.com ([fe80::60aa:f95:ad49:a0f1]) by ex-hc3.corp.adtran.com ([fe80::3892:20fa:600f:75c6%15]) with mapi id 14.03.0195.001; Mon, 8 Sep 2014 10:46:55 -0500 From: ANDY KENNEDY To: "buildroot@uclibc.org" Thread-Topic: [PATCH] parted not building static Thread-Index: Ac/LfB3nAVrYN1kDSlWGDtuhPeDFtQ== Date: Mon, 8 Sep 2014 15:46:55 +0000 Message-ID: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: x-originating-ip: [172.22.115.180] MIME-Version: 1.0 X-AnalysisOut: [v=2.1 cv=EO8S0jpC c=1 sm=1 tr=0 a=J+LXdEUA8t8MtBPt16/Qbg==] X-AnalysisOut: [:117 a=J+LXdEUA8t8MtBPt16/Qbg==:17 a=eo0mrVV_XuoA:10 a=21X] X-AnalysisOut: [J7v_MK3IA:10 a=qZHQZMT3apYA:10 a=C3ZOIDTcl6cA:10 a=BLceEmw] X-AnalysisOut: [cHowA:10 a=kj9zAlcOel0A:10 a=xqWC_Br6kY4A:10 a=eJNrpioGAAA] X-AnalysisOut: [A:8 a=YlVTAMxIAAAA:8 a=3iq_S118s8vBhiOmdVwA:9 a=CjuIK1q_8u] X-AnalysisOut: [gA:10 a=DvnSUQUdWHYA:10] X-Spam: [F=0.5000000000; CM=0.500; MH=0.500(2014090808); S=0.200(2014051901)] X-MAIL-FROM: X-SOURCE-IP: [76.164.174.82] Subject: [Buildroot] [PATCH] parted not building static X-BeenThere: buildroot@busybox.net X-Mailman-Version: 2.1.14 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: buildroot-bounces@busybox.net Sender: buildroot-bounces@busybox.net Parted would not build when PREFER_STATIC_LIB was selected. The configure error reports "Add --disable-dynamic-loading" as the fix. Added this fix. Signed-off-by: Andy Kennedy diff -Naur a/package/parted/parted.mk b/package/parted/parted.mk --- a/package/parted/parted.mk 2014-02-27 14:51:23.000000000 -0600 +++ b/package/parted/parted.mk 2014-09-08 10:37:39.288121610 -0500 @@ -19,6 +19,10 @@ PARTED_CONF_OPT += --without-readline endif +ifeq ($(BR2_PREFER_STATIC_LIB),y) +PARTED_CONF_OPT += --disable-dynamic-loading +endif + ifeq ($(BR2_PACKAGE_LVM2),y) PARTED_DEPENDENCIES += lvm2 PARTED_CONF_OPT += --enable-device-mapper